Description
Collected together in words and pictures Those Summers of Cricket pays homage to Richie Benaud's life. The many contributions bring his life into sharp focus for the many generations who only know him as the 'voice' of cricket. And through each piece, often written by an ex-Australian cricket team member or captain or cricket writer or sports commentator or Richie Benaud himself, we learn more about the brilliant career that unfolded.
Along the way the many accolades accorded Richie as he went from club cricket, district and State cricket to leading the Australian Cricket Team are documented from newspapers and reports.
Richie Benaud's own words tell of growing up in Jugiong and later western Sydney. His brother tells of Richie's selection into the Australian cricket team. Among the contributing pieces to this anthology are those from ex-Test captains Greg Chappell and Ian Chappell; ex-coach Australian cricket coach John Buchanan; ex-Australian cricketers Dennis Lillee and Alan Davidson; cricket writers Gideon Haigh, Simon Hughes, Malcolm Knox, Leo McKinstry (UK), Jim White (UK), Daniel Brettig, Steve Cannane, and commentator Mike Atherton.
All are opinionated and fascinating reading. All bring to life the many faces of Richie Benaud in this warm and colourful tribute.
